JUDGMENT
Pankaj Bhandari - Petitioner has preferred this revision petition aggrieved by judgment and order dated 04.10.2016 passed by Additional Chief Judicial Magistrate Rajgarh, District Alwar, whereby the petitioner has been convicted for offence under Section 419, 354, 170 & 323 IPC and has been sentenced to undergo two years rigorous imprisonment for offence under Section 419 IPC and fine of Rs.2000/- and on non-payment of fine to further undergo two months simple imprisonment, for offence under Section 354 IPC, petitioner has been sentenced one year rigorous imprisonment and fine of Rs.1,000/- on non-payment of fine to further undergo one month simple imprisonment, for offence under Section 170 IPC, he has been sentenced two years simple imprisonment and fine of Rs.2,000/- on non-payment of fine to further undergo two months simple imprisonment and for offence under Section 323IPC, he has been sentenced for six months simple imprisonment and fine of Rs. 1,000/- on non-payment of fine to further undergo one month simple imprisonment.
